3580639
0x207880558386b178c1ecb1fc54ce0d1fbe30642e48611de433f91faabab69c6a
Transactions0
Height3580639
Confirmations10661696
Timestamp895 days 9 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xf0b3f34430f1ab8c
Bits
Difficulty0xde1f548